[Notas] Acerca del uso de sscanf y sprintf

El uso de sscanf y sprintf
sscanf es escribir str an en el formato de "% d" (de izquierda a derecha)

Código

​
//#include<bits/stdc++.h>  
#include<cstdio>
#include<iostream>
#include<cstring>

using namespace std;


int main()
{
	char str[100]="11111";
	int n;
	sscanf(str,"%d",&n);
	cout<<n;
}

​

Sprintf escribe n en str en el formato "% d" (ejecutado de derecha a izquierda)

Código

//#include<bits/stdc++.h>  
#include<cstdio>
#include<iostream>
#include<cstring>

using namespace std;


int main()
{
	char str[100];
	int n=11111;
	sprintf(str,"%d",n);
	cout<<str;
}

 

Supongo que te gusta

Origin blog.csdn.net/melon_sama/article/details/107930040
Recomendado
Clasificación